Detailed Procedure to Calculate Impact Force for m = 762 lb, v = 797 mph & d = 100 mm

The formula for impact force expressed in terms of the body's velocity (speed) on impact (v), its mass (m), and the collision distance (d) is the formula below:

F =
m x v2 / d

Where,

F = Impact Force

m = Mass of object

v = velocity

d = collision distance


Step by Step Solution to find impact force of Mass = 762 lb & Velocity = 797 mph & Distance = 100 mm:

Given that,

mass (m) = 762 lb

velocity (v) = 797 mph

distance (d) = 100 mm

Convert the mass 762 lb to "Kilograms (kg)"

Mass in Kg = 762 ÷ 2.204623

Mass in kg = 345.6373 kg

Convert Velocity value 797 mph to " m/s"

Velocity in m/s = 797 ÷ 2.237

Velocity in m/s = 356.2807 m/s

Convert Distance value 100 mm to " m"

Distance in m = 100 ÷ 1000

Distance in m = 0.1 m

Substitute the value into the formula

F =
345.6373 x (356.2807)2 / 0.1

F = 219369030.728762 N

∴ Imapct Force (F) = 219369030.728762 N
